> This allows clients to ensure the injected Parser supports the formats they need, e.g.:
> public static final String PARSER_FILTER =
> "(&("+SupportedFormat.supportedFormat+"=" + SupportedFormat.RDF_XML + ") "+
> "("+SupportedFormat.supportedFormat+"=" + SupportedFormat.N_TRIPLE + "))";
> @Reference(target = PARSER_FILTER)
> private Parser parser;
> The parser needs to adapt the service properties when a parsing provider is added or removed.
